Joby Aviation, Inc. (NYSE:JOBY – Get Free Report) traded down 4.7% on Thursday . The company traded as low as $12.99 and last traded at $13.0240. 26,172,302 shares were traded during mid-day trading, a decline of 3% from the average session volume of 27,115,777 shares. The stock had previously closed at $13.67.
Analyst Ratings Changes
JOBY has been the subject of several recent research reports. Zacks Research raised shares of Joby Aviation from a “strong sell” rating to a “hold” rating in a research report on Tuesday, November 4th. Canaccord Genuity Group downgraded shares of Joby Aviation from a “buy” rating to a “hold” rating and upped their target price for the company from $12.00 to $17.00 in a research note on Thursday, August 7th. Weiss Ratings reaffirmed a “sell (d-)” rating on shares of Joby Aviation in a report on Wednesday, October 8th. Morgan Stanley boosted their price objective on shares of Joby Aviation from $7.00 to $15.00 and gave the stock an “equal weight” rating in a report on Thursday, October 9th. Finally, JPMorgan Chase & Co. upped their price objective on shares of Joby Aviation from $7.00 to $8.00 and gave the company an “underweight” rating in a research report on Friday, October 31st. One research analyst has rated the stock with a Buy rating, five have assigned a Hold rating and two have given a Sell r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at, Joby Aviation presently has an average rating of “Reduce” and a consensus target price of $14.00.

Joby Aviation Stock Up 0.4%
Joby Aviation (NYSE:JOBY –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, November 6th. The company reported ($0.48)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.19) by ($0.29). The business had revenue of $22.57 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$0.02 million.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 7962.1%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ned ($0.21) EPS. Analysts predict that Joby Aviation, Inc. will post -0.69 earnings per share for the current year.

About Joby Aviation
Joby Aviation, Inc, a vertically integrated air mobility company, engages in building an electric vertical takeoff and landing aircraft optimized to deliver air transportation as a service. The company intends to build an aerial ridesharing service, as well as developing an application-based platform that will enable consumers to book rides.
